What must a Florida license applicant submit so the Department of Financial Services can complete the required background check?

Why A is correct

Under Florida licensing law administered by the Department of Financial Services, applicants must submit fingerprints so state and federal criminal history record checks can be completed as part of the background review. The background check supports DFS's evaluation of the applicant's character and trustworthiness for licensure.

Why the other options are wrong

  • B) Credit reports are not the required background instrument; fingerprint-based criminal history checks are.
  • C) Employment references may accompany an application but do not satisfy the background check requirement.
  • D) No medical examination is required to qualify for a Florida insurance agent license.

Memory hook

Fingerprints first: DFS runs the background check.
